## Onboarding: Plugins for Murmur Guide

Murmur Guide is the audio-guide app used by the Fenwick Gallery. External plugins add tour narration, translations, and exhibit triggers.

Basics:

- Plugins are packaged as `.mgx` bundles.
- Every bundle must be signed before the Fenwick catalog will list it.
- Unsigned bundles run only in the local simulator.
- Submit via the Murmur partner portal; review takes about three days.

Sign your first test bundle with the shared sandbox key, which is included below.

signing key of bagap-yawep = bky13_TbfT6ZMUoGJo2

## Onboarding: Flagship Rollouts

New reviewers: the Flagship framework gates every rollout behind `FLAGSHIP_ENV` and `FLAGSHIP_DEFAULT_STATE=off`. Check that PRs never hardcode flag values and that percentage ramps are defined in the manifest, not in code. The evaluator syncs rules from the control plane, authenticating with a key stored in the env file; that assignment belongs on the next line.

sealed setting: RELAY_SECRET5=82864

**FAQ: Can contractors use the bike cage and parking gates?**

Yes. The bike cage at Dornick Yard is beside Gate 2; secure your bike to a rack, not the fence. The vehicle gates open on approach during business hours but require a code after 18:00. For both the cage door and the after-hours gate keypad, enter the code below.

turnstile pass: bdg-FVNQRS-72965873

Ticket: Vault lockout on Pagerhush dedup service. The on-call alert deduplicator for Team Brindlewood can't pull its signing key — the Coffervault instance locked itself after three bad unseal attempts during last night's failover. Dedup still runs on cached config, but new alert routes won't register. Security review needed before we force-unseal. Per policy, I'm documenting the break-glass path here. The recovery passphrase for the sealed vault is:

vault phrase of kawep-tahog = ulaix-briath